Bollywood's evolution is marked by distinct phases, each contributing to its rich tapestry. The early days of Bollywood, from the 1930s to the 1960s, were characterized by melodramatic narratives, romantic themes, and elaborate musical numbers. These films often drew inspiration from Indian literature and folklore, laying the foundation for future storytelling techniques. The industry's golden age, spanning the 1970s to the 1990s, saw the emergence of iconic films and legendary actors. During this period, Bollywood trends were defined by larger-than-life heroes, intense action sequences, and memorable song-and-dance routines. These elements not only captivated domestic audiences but also began to attract international attention.

As we transition into the modern era, Bollywood trends reflect a harmonious blend of tradition and innovation. The industry's commitment to inclusivity and diversity is evident in its storytelling choices. Films featuring strong female leads, LGBTQ+ themes, and regional narratives have gained prominence, resonating with a broader audience. This shift is not merely a reflection of changing societal values but also a strategic move to cater to evolving audience preferences. Additionally, the rise of digital platforms has revolutionized the way Bollywood content is consumed. Streaming services have democratized access to films, enabling new filmmakers and content creators to showcase their work. Short films and web series have become popular mediums for storytelling, offering fresh perspectives and innovative narratives.
Social media's influence on Bollywood trends cannot be overstated. Platforms like Instagram, Twitter, and TikTok have transformed the way celebrities interact with fans, creating a more personal and engaging experience. This direct connection shapes trends in fashion, lifestyle choices, and public opinion on films. Furthermore, viral challenges and memes originating from Bollywood content have become powerful tools for film promotion and audience engagement. These trends not only enhance the visibility of films but also foster cultural conversations around them. For instance, the success of a film can often be gauged by its presence in trending topics and the volume of memes it generates.
Among the notable Bolly4U trends, remakes and adaptations stand out as significant contributors to the industry's growth. By revisiting classic films or adapting international stories, filmmakers tap into nostalgia while introducing fresh perspectives. This approach has proven successful in attracting both older audiences and new generations. Collaborations with international artists have also gained momentum, resulting in cross-cultural projects that blend diverse musical styles. Such collaborations enhance Bollywood's visibility on global platforms, providing artists with opportunities to expand their reach and influence. For example, the partnership between Bollywood composers and Western musicians has produced chart-topping tracks that appeal to audiences worldwide.
